실시간 End-to-End transaction 관리

OpenMCM은 모든 구간(Web-WAS-TP monitor)에 있어 실시간 End-to-End transaction 및 업무 관점의 개별 Business 관리를 위한 차별화된 기능을 제공합니다.

  • LOB, IT 관점에서의 전사통합서비스 시스템 관리
  • Application 수정 및 개발자 개입이 필요 없는 Non-Program 방식
  • 특정구간에 대한 단순 Monitoring (Class기준) 수준이 아닌, 서비스 관점에서의 Multi-Product Enabler (E2E Management) 기능 제공
  • 개별 트랜잭션이 수행되는 이동경로에 대해 노드, 프로세스, 서비스 단위 정보 및 외부주소, 수행시간 등을 제공

Application 별 성능정보

  • System Application 별 TPS (초당 Transaction 수행 건수),일일 총 실행 건수, 평균 응답시간 정보 등 조회 기능.
  • WAS Application 별로 Active/Idle Queue, 총 Request 수 등의 정보 제공
  • TP Application 별로 Queue에 대기 중인 건수 및 총 처리건수 정보 제공
  • 구간 내 어플리케이션 별로 CPU, Memory 등의 시스템 별 자원 사용률 정보 제공

비정상 거래의 문제 최소화를 위한 Dynamic 제어

  • 지속적인 문제를 일으키는 개별 Transaction에 대한 원천적인 봉쇄
  • 미등록서비스 Blocking 또는 장애상황이 감지되는 Thread 단위의 Control (Pending / Deadlock)

장애 극소화를 위한 자동화 기능 구현

E2E 실시간 트랜잭션 모니터링 및 Auto-Detection 기능을 통하여 문제에 대한 이상징후를 감지하고, 문제 트랜잭션 화면으로 이동 후 신속히 문제를 분석하고, 유형별 문제 트랜잭션에 대한 조치 후 정상 처리여부 확인할 수 있는 Top-Down Navigation 구성 체계

  • 운영 환경 기반의 시나리오
  • 실시간 이상징후 예측, 자동 감지, 통보, 자동 장애처리
  • 악성 Application에 대한 튜닝가이드 제공
    • – CPU Hotspot/Allocated Object/Lock
    • – Contention/Heavy SQL/Exception/Etc
  • Transaction ID 별 자세한 Session Tracker
  • Kill lock-Session 제어
  • Top 10 Heavy SQL Analyzer(Elapsed Time / Executed SQL/Etc)